John Cena: The Doctor of Thuganomics Steps to the Mic
John Cena, the face that runs the place, the leader of the Cenation, and the original Doctor of Thuganomics, is no stranger to the world of rap. Before he was slinging Five Knuckle Shuffles and Attitude Adjustments, Cena was spitting rhymes, dropping beats, and rocking chains. His "You Can't See Me" persona was built on a foundation of hip-hop swagger, and his early WWE career saw him delivering freestyle raps that were both hilarious and surprisingly sharp. Cena's rap skills are more than just a gimmick; they're a genuine part of his persona and a testament to his ability to connect with audiences. In a rap battle scenario, Cena would undoubtedly bring the heat with clever wordplay, pop culture references, and plenty of disses aimed at his opponent's weaknesses. He's got the charisma, the stage presence, and the lyrical ability to make this a truly memorable event. Imagine Cena dropping lines about Angle's Olympic gold medal, turning his serious accomplishments into comedic fodder. Or picture him poking fun at Angle's infamous moments, like driving the milk truck or singing "Jimmy Crack Corn." Cena's strength lies in his ability to blend humor with genuine rap skills, making him a formidable opponent in any lyrical confrontation.
